I'm interested in determining whether or not a clear canon has emerged within the world of IF/hypertext. Of course, there is a clear critical opinion regarding which works belong to this tentative canon, but I'm interested in what readers and fans of the genre feel. I mean 'canon' in the traditional literary sense. For the sake of clarity I will define it here less as a coherent, codified list of works and more as a loose assemblage held in the minds (and in this case lists) of readers, reviewers, and critics.

The Hobbit, by Philip Mitchell and Veronika Megler 3 votes "A true classic" [+]"A true classic: I bring this game up whenever there is a discussion of classic or canonic status. It was extremely influential on the European 8-bit IF market, and it is probably one of the biggest-selling non-Infocoms ever. It also showed that you can make a complex game even with very limited hardware." ( 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| |
